The Church of the Holy Trinity, Episcopal, is gearing up for an annual tradition so old that church members aren’t sure exactly when it started.

The Holy Trinity turkey dinner and bake sale will be from 11 a.m. to 1:30 p.m. Nov. 18 at the church’s parish hall at South and Monroe streets.

“This is a great event to eat a delicious meal and tour our beautiful, historic church,” said Donna Saunders, chairman of the event.

Served will be turkey and dressing, cranberry salad, green beans, a roll and a drink. Cost is $10, and tickets must be purchased in advance. Patrons may dine in or take a plate to go.
